First, let's get to know travertine. This natural stone has been loved for centuries for its unique porous texture and warm, earthy tones—think of the ancient Roman structures that still stand tall, their walls adorned with travertine's timeless beauty. But traditional travertine, while stunning, comes with drawbacks: it's heavy, prone to cracking in extreme temperatures, and often requires constant sealing to resist water damage. You might be wondering, "How do these tiles stand up to the elements?" The secret lies in MCM, or Modified Cementitious Material. Unlike traditional cement-based products that are brittle and heavy, MCM is a blend of high-grade cement, natural minerals, and special additives that undergo a unique modification process. The result? A material that's 50% lighter than natural stone , yet 3 times stronger in impact resistance. For exterior walls, this means less stress on the building's structure and a lower risk of cracks or breakage over time.

Exterior walls face a daily battle against nature's elements. In hot climates, UV rays can fade colors and weaken materials; in cold regions, freeze-thaw cycles cause traditional stones to expand and crack; in coastal areas, salt spray eats away at porous surfaces.
